Highest common factor (HCF) of 3880, 2066 is 2.
Step 1: Since 3880 > 2066, we apply the division lemma to 3880 and 2066, to get
3880 = 2066 x 1 + 1814
Step 2: Since the reminder 2066 ≠ 0, we apply division lemma to 1814 and 2066, to get
2066 = 1814 x 1 + 252
Step 3: We consider the new divisor 1814 and the new remainder 252, and apply the division lemma to get
1814 = 252 x 7 + 50
We consider the new divisor 252 and the new remainder 50,and apply the division lemma to get
252 = 50 x 5 + 2
We consider the new divisor 50 and the new remainder 2,and apply the division lemma to get
50 = 2 x 25 + 0
The remainder has now become zero, so our procedure stops. Since the divisor at this stage is 2, the HCF of 3880 and 2066 is 2
Notice that 2 = HCF(50,2) = HCF(252,50) = HCF(1814,252) = HCF(2066,1814) = HCF(3880,2066) .
